Forensic Medicine: Animal Crime Investigation

Learn the inner workings of a career in veterinary forensics, and the education, skills, and experience necessary to enter this field of veterinary practice.​ Dr. Melinda Merck, a forensic veterinarian and owner of Veterinary Forensics Consulting in Austin, Texas, discusses her experiences working with investigators of animal cruelty and crime scene investigation in this unique field.

Participants can expect to learn:

  • How forensic veterinarians assist in the investigation and prosecution of animal cruelty cases
  • The day-to-day work of a forensic veterinarian
  • The education, skills, and experience needed to enter the field of veterinary forensics
  • Career opportunities in veterinary forensics

Dr. Melinda Merck is the owner of Veterinary Forensics Consulting in Austin, Texas. She assists investigators of animal cruelty with crime scene investigation, examination of live and deceased victims, frequently testifying as a veterinary forensics expert. She helps with large scale operations including exhumations of burial sites and examination of skeletal animal remains. Dr. Merck provides training for veterinary, attorney and law enforcement professionals internationally on the use of veterinary forensic science and medicine in the investigation and prosecution of animal cruelty cases.

Dr. Merck is the Past President of the Board of Directors for North American Veterinary Community and Program Chair for their Veterinary Forensics: Animal CSI program. She is the founding chair of the Board of Directors for the International Veterinary Forensic Sciences Association. She serves on the WSAVA Animal Wellness and Welfare Committee and the Association of Prosecuting Attorney’s Animal Cruelty Advisory Council. Dr. Merck is the editor and contributing author of several textbooks and developed the first Veterinary Forensics course for the University of Georgia and Florida veterinary schools and frequently lectures at other veterinary and technician colleges.
